16-bit

Projects inspired by the 16 bit console generation from the late 80s and early 90s. Including the consoles Super Nintendo, Sega Genesis, and PC Engine/TurboGrafx-16.

16x16

16 pixels by 16 pixels is a common resolution for assets matching a low-res pixel art aesthetic. Although the assets may not be specifically 16x16, they are designed to work in a graphical setting where objects are around that size.
